The Bees went to Elland Road to face Marcelo Bielsa’s side but Thomas Frank’s charges were beaten 1-0 by the Whites who scored a late winner.

Following the 1-0 Championship defeat to Leeds United at Elland Road, a number of Brentford fans made their feelings known about their side’s performance and whether Thomas Frank is the right man to guide the Bees.
Brentford had hoped to get back on track after a mixed start to the season which began with a surprise home loss to Birmingham City, before a win over Middlesbrough, a shock loss to League Two Cambridge United in the Carabao Cup, and a draw with Hull City.
However, a late Eddie Nketiah goal condemned the Bees to a 1-0 defeat at Elland Road, their second loss from their opening four league games and their first away from home, leaving them six points adrift of the Whites, who returned to the top of the table, and second-placed Swansea City.
